staging: comedi: das1800: use comedi_timeout()
authorH Hartley Sweeten <hsweeten@visionengravers.com>
Fri, 8 Apr 2016 19:41:51 +0000 (12:41 -0700)
committerGreg Kroah-Hartman <gregkh@linuxfoundation.org>
Fri, 29 Apr 2016 05:16:10 +0000 (22:16 -0700)
Use the helper function to handle the busywaiting for the analog
input conversion to complete.
